Wild Goose Qigong belongs to the Kunlun School,also called Kunlun School Qigong. It is also named as DaYanQiGong.
It was practised by a famous practitioner named Dao An in Jin Dynasty (265-420 A.D.). He was later crowned as its founder. Wild Goose Qigong spread to northern China and was kept by Wan Li at Wutai Mountain. Wild Goose QiGong is able to pass down to the present as Emperor Qian Long, in Qing Dynasty (1368-1840 A.D.), promoted religion and established temples all over the country"
大雁气功属昆仑派气功,以晋代道安为宗师(265-420 A.D.)之后由五台山高僧万宜长老,整理保存下来,在乾隆帝提倡宗教时此功法才得面世留传到今日。 也是中国流传民间历史悠久的著名功法之一。能提高广大群众的健康体质,防治疾病有保健治疗的功用
